AMD hires analyst to boost business sales
Advanced Micro Devices has hired former Gartner analyst Kevin Knox to serve as an evangelist to corporate computer makers and information technology managers. AMD has been trying for years, without great success, to get its chips inside of PCs sold to large businesses. The corporate climate, however, is warming up for AMD. The Sunnyvale, Calif.-based chipmaker has shown it can manufacture chips in volume and match or beat rival Intel on certain performance benchmarks. NEC has decided to incorporate the company's Athlon and Duron chips in business PCs in select European markets.
